About this property
Historic Charm: Turrock Cottage in Shillelagh offers a spacious holiday home housed in a historic building. Guests enjoy garden and terrace views, complemented by mountain vistas. Modern Amenities: The property features a fully equipped kitchen, washing machine, and free private parking. Additional amenities include a fireplace, dining area, and free toiletries. Local Attractions: Located 96 km from Dublin Airport, Turrock Cottage is near Mount Wolseley Golf Club (16 km) and Altamont Gardens (24 km). Other points of interest include Carlow College and Carlow Town Hall, each 30 km away. Guest Favorites: Guests highly rate the host, who provides excellent service and ensures a comfortable stay.
